logo

Output ef32e80004b9c895c12d424128d4594e319ebc3f42fc43463fcbfbe88c91877b:1

value
12878407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e632607fe1271f7dda6e580b7887da994c36635 OP_EQUALVERIFY OP_CHECKSIG
address
1B4g74iPn65K1zq3RoUU5CGx8i6m3YHWz1
transaction
ef32e80004b9c895c12d424128d4594e319ebc3f42fc43463fcbfbe88c91877b